#fc605c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c605c is composed of 98.8% red, 37.6%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 1.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 67.5%. #fc605c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0b8 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#fc605c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fc605c has RGB values of R:252, G:96,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.63,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16539740.

Shades and Tints of #fc605c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0000 is the darkest color, while #fff6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c605c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afa9a9 is the less saturated color, while #fc605c is the most saturated one.
